您可以启动,停止和重新启动 Docker 容器当我们停止一个容器时,它并没有被移除,而是状态变成了stopped,容器内的进程也停止了当我们docker ps在上一个模块中运行命令时,默认输出仅显示正在运行的容器当我们通过——all或—a简称时,我们会看到机器上的所有容器,而不管它们的启动或停止状态
$ docker ps —a
您现在应该看到列出了几个容器这些是我们启动和停止但尚未删除的容器
让我们重新启动刚刚停止的容器找到我们刚刚停止的容器名称,在restart命令中替换下面的容器名称
$ docker restart wonderful_kalam
现在使用docker ps命令再次列出所有容器。
$ docker ps ——all
请注意,我们刚刚重新启动的容器已在分离模式下启动并暴露了端口 5000另外,观察容器的状态是Up X seconds当您重新启动容器时,它会以与最初启动时相同的标志或命令启动
现在,让我们停止并移除我们所有的容器,看看如何修复随机命名问题停止我们刚刚启动的容器找到您正在运行的容器的名称,并将以下命令中的名称替换为您系统上的容器名称
$ docker stop wonderful_kalam
现在我们所有的容器都已停止,让我们将它们移除当你移除一个容器时,它不再运行,也不是处于停止状态,而是容器内部的进程已经停止并且容器的元数据已经被移除
$ docker ps ——all
要删除容器,只需运行docker rm传递容器名称的命令即可您可以使用单个命令将多个容器名称传递给命令同样,将以下命令中的容器名称替换为您系统中的容器名称
$ docker rm wonderful_kalam agitated_moser goofy_khayyam
docker ps ——all再次运行该命令以查看所有容器都已删除。
现在,让我们解决随机命名问题标准做法是为您的容器命名,原因很简单,这样更容易识别容器中运行的内容以及与它关联的应用程序或服务
要命名容器,我们只需要将——name标志传递给docker run命令。有关resolv.conf的有效选项,请参见操作系统文档.。
$ docker run —d —p 5000:5000 ——name rest—server python—docker
这样更好!我们现在可以根据名称轻松识别我们的容器。代表DNS选项及其值的键值对。
。郑重声明:此文内容为本网站转载企业宣传资讯,目的在于传播更多信息,与本站立场无关。仅供读者参考,并请自行核实相关内容。
-
盘扣式脚手架有哪些优点?四川远方模架告诉你答案!新浪网消息:四川远方模架科技有限公司位于四川省成都市,创建于2017年。公司拥有M60型盘扣脚手架总量达30000余吨,具有...
-
区块链如何跨越未来10年“十四五”时期,随着全球数字化进程的深入推进,区块链产业竞争将更加激烈。作为新兴数字产业之一,区块链在产业变革中发挥着重要作...
-
三人篮球将首登奥运舞台 国家三人男女篮签署反兴奋剂为实现东京奥运会兴奋剂问题“零出现”的目标,近日,中国篮协反兴奋剂委员会分别前往山东济南和上海崇明训练基地,为国家三人男、女...
-
同气连枝,共盼春来!宜品乳业捐赠82万元物资助力黑河
2021-11-16 17:54
-
罗永浩吐槽苹果文案没文化网友从截图发现社交软件Sou
2021-11-16 17:38
-
国货蜂花否认倒闭传闻:10年仅涨2元的洗护发民族品牌
2021-11-16 17:36
-
小米有品不再独立:服务人群和小米商城不一样
2021-11-16 17:01
-
vivo发布入门级新机Y15A:联发科HelioP3
2021-11-16 16:50
-
《星辰大海》简爱和方恒之在一起了吗星辰大海简爱和方恒
2021-11-16 16:10
-
收评:A股三大指数震荡收跌,酿酒、医药板块领涨,军工
2021-11-16 15:59
-
油气巨头壳牌计划将总部迁往英国:摘掉“荷兰皇家”字样
2021-11-16 15:42
-
保龄宝:公司目前赤藓糖醇产能约3万吨
2021-11-16 15:38
-
平安退保去哪里办理?能否全额退保呢?
2021-11-16 15:28